Isla Santa María, also known as Floreana Island, is one of the inhabited islands within the Galápagos archipelago, specifically part of San Cristóbal canton in Ecuador. Located approximately 50 kilometers south of Santa Cruz Island in the Pacific Ocean, it occupies a central position within the Galápagos island chain. With a land area of approximately 173 square kilometers, Isla Santa María is the sixth largest island in the archipelago and has a small permanent population of around 100 residents. The island is divided into several distinct geographical zones including the highland areas, coastal regions, and the small settlement of Puerto Velasco Ibarra. Historically significant as the first island to be permanently inhabited in the Galápagos, Isla Santa María features diverse ecosystems ranging from arid coastal zones to lush highland forests, and serves as an important nesting site for sea turtles and flamingos. The island's unique geography includes several notable features such as Crown Peak, the island's highest point at 640 meters, and Post Office Bay, which contains the historic wooden barrel that has served as a post office for passing sailors since the 18th century.
